What Is Civil 3D?

Civil 3D is an Autodesk modeling application that is used to design and document civil engineering projects. It was first released in 2005 and is used for many different types of civil infrastructure projects including land development, rail projects, bridges, water systems, and roads and highways. Civil 3D uses a 3D model-based environment, and it supports Building Information Modeling (BIM) workflows. It has specific tools for many different civil engineering features including tools for grading, parcel layout, surfaces, and corridor design. Its automated features let designers streamline many time-consuming tasks.

Civil 3D also facilitates collaboration among team members. This application integrates data from a variety of sources, such as survey data and GIS data. It can also exchange information with other Autodesk applications, like AutoCAD and Revit. In addition, it allows team members to work simultaneously on the same project and make real-time updates. With Civil 3D, team members can maintain consistency for data and processes, and respond more quickly to any project changes.

Why Learn Civil 3D?

Fluency in Civil 3D is a fundamental skill required for many professional roles in the field of civil engineering. Working in this field can be lucrative and civil engineering jobs are expected to experience strong growth over the next ten years. The U.S. Bureau of Labor Statistics (BLS) is a federal agency that collects and analyzes U.S. labor market information. Between 2023 and 2033, it predicts that civil engineering jobs will grow by 6 percent, which is faster than the average U.S. job growth rate of 4 percent. The agency explains, “With continued investment in U.S. infrastructure, civil engineers will be needed to manage projects that meet society's need for upgrading bridges, roads, water systems, buildings, and other structures.” In addition, it says, “Civil engineers also will be needed to oversee renewable-energy projects, such as construction of wind farms and solar arrays, as these projects gain approval.” The median pay for a Civil Engineer is almost $96,000 per year, according to BLS.

What Careers Use Civil 3D?

Engineers often use Civil 3D, particularly Civil Engineers. Civil Engineers design, construct, and maintain a variety of infrastructure projects like water systems, roads, and bridges. They work in both offices and construction sites. According to the U.S. Bureau of Labor Statistics (BLS), over the next ten years jobs in this field will grow by 6 percent, which is faster than average, with almost 23,000 job openings projected each year on average. It says, “Civil engineers will be needed to manage projects that meet society's need for upgrading bridges, roads, water systems, buildings, and other structures.” In addition, it states, “Civil engineers also will be needed to oversee renewable-energy projects, such as construction of wind farms and solar arrays, as these projects gain approval.” The median pay for a Civil Engineer is $95,000 according to BLS.

Architects also use this application. Architects design buildings and other structures, and oversee their construction. BLS projects 8 percent job growth for this field between 2023 and 2033, with about 8,500 job openings each year. BLS says, “Architects are expected to be needed to make plans and designs, particularly in sustainable design, for the construction and renovation of homes, schools, healthcare facilities, and other structures.” In addition, it notes, “Improved building information modeling (BIM) software and measuring technology are expected to allow architects to take on activities once performed by other workers, such as architectural and civil drafters, interior designers, and engineers.” It reports that the median pay for an Architect is $93,000.

A Drafter may also use Civil 3D. Drafters use computer software such as Civil 3D to create technical drawings and plans. They may specialize in a specific field such as civil engineering, mechanical drafting, or architectural design. BLS reports that the majority of drafting jobs in the United States are for Architectural and Civil Drafters. The next most common type of drafting job is mechanical drafting, followed by electrical and electronics drafting. BLS predicts that jobs in this field may decrease in the next ten years as a result of applications like Civil 3D. It explains, “Expected employment decreases will be driven by the use of computer-aided design (CAD) and building information modeling (BIM) technologies. These technologies increase drafter productivity and allow engineers and architects to perform many tasks that used to be done by drafters.” The median pay for a drafter is $62,000, according to BLS.

Another role where Civil 3D may be used is that of Surveyor. Surveyors use specialized equipment to measure land and property boundaries. They create maps and reports that are used for construction, real estate transactions, or legal purposes. Fieldwork and travel are often required. Job growth in this field is expected to be 6 percent over the next ten years, according to BLS. It says, “Surveyors will continue to be needed to certify boundary lines and review sites for construction. Employment demand also will be tied to projects such as road repair and mining activities, although the use of drones and other technologies may limit growth somewhat by increasing worker productivity.” The median pay for a Surveyor is $68,000, as reported by BLS.

Why Learn In a Live Online Class?

There are many reasons to learn Civil 3D in a live online class. One advantage of live online learning is that you interact with your instructor and fellow students in real-time. This can make class more engaging, and it also allows you to ask questions and get immediate feedback. A live online class also allows you to interact with other students which has benefits too including the opportunity to network, the chance to be exposed to diverse viewpoints, and the support that can come through a shared learning experience. 

Many students also like the flexibility that comes with live online learning. Rather than having to commute to class at a specific location, they can attend from anywhere that they want. There are no travel costs and no time spent commuting. This flexibility can make it easier to balance learning with other obligations such as work or family.

Another benefit of live online learning is that you’re likely to have access to more class options, since you won’t be limited to classes that you can commute to. Since live online classes are often attended by students all over the country you might also find that this type of class exposes you to a more diverse range of students and perspectives.

Alternatives to Live Online Classes

If a live online class doesn’t fit with your schedule or sound like the right training format for you, there are a number of other ways to learn Civil 3D. Self-paced classes are one popular alternative. When you take a self-paced class, you’ll still follow a structured and comprehensive training program under the guidance of an expert instructor. However, unlike with a live online course, you’ll work through the material at your own pace. You don’t get live instruction, but you do get instructor support. For instance, you’re likely to get regular feedback and answers to your questions. Many self-paced classes also include discussions with classmates.

If you’re looking for a less expensive option, you could try on-demand training. Like self-paced classes, on-demand classes consist of a set of pre-recorded lessons and exercises. There is no live instructor. However, most on-demand classes don’t generally come with the same level of instructor support or interaction with classmates as self-paced ones.

A third training option is an in-person class. Many people find that this is the most engaging format. Some students say that they find it easier to learn something new when they learn in-person, and some instructors say that they find it easier to understand then students need additional help. When you learn in-person it can also be easier to interact with other students, which can lead to valuable networking relationships. However, this format offers the least flexibility of all learning methods. You have to commute to class at a specific time, which can be time-consuming, inconvenient, and expensive. Additionally, you’re limited to classes that run in your immediate vicinity.

Another option is free learning resources. Autodesk offers many free short Civil 3D tutorials on its website including tutorials that cover the Civil 3D user interface and basic tools, and others that are focused on specific topics such as surfaces, corridors, alignments, and grading. YouTube also contains free Civil 3D tutorials. You can also look at online forums, where you may meet experts who are happy to share learning advice. Some school websites offer free information to help students gain a better understanding of this application before they choose a class. Free resources can be a good way to start getting a feel for Civil 3D, learn some basic skills, or troubleshoot a particular problem, however, most are not very comprehensive, and you may also find that some are outdated or inaccurate. Most people who are serious about learning Civil 3D end up enrolling in a paid course.

Level of Difficulty, Prerequisites, and Cost to Learn Civil 3D

Civil 3D is a technical application with many complex tools and can be relatively difficult to learn at first. You may find the learning process easier if you already know how to use AutoCAD. Civil 3D and AutoCAD are both computer-aided drafting (CAD) applications, and they have many similarities in their user interface and the tools offered. A background in design can also be helpful. However, almost anyone can master this application. Most people find the guidance and feedback offered in a formal Civil 3D class to be very helpful in the learning process. Regular practice can also help mastering Civil 3D seem less difficult.

If you take a Civil 3D class that is designed for beginners, there are unlikely to be any prerequisites. However, you’re likely to learn more quickly and easily if you do have some related experience. Since Civil 3D is designed for civil engineering projects, users need an understanding of basic civil engineering concepts like surveying and infrastructure design. An understanding of 3D modeling is also helpful, but not required. While 2D modeling involves creating a flat representation of something, 3D modeling adds a third dimension and requires different spatial reasoning skills. It can be challenging to learn at first.

Civil 3D is an Autodesk application. You can get a free 30-day trial, and after that, the application is available by subscription. Autodesk offers both monthly and yearly subscription plans. It also offers a pay-as-you-go plan called Flex, where you can buy tokens that can be used to access Civil 3D for 24 hours at a time. Students and educators can get free access to Civil 3D which is valid for a year and is renewable if they remain eligible. In addition to the cost of the application, there is the cost associated with taking a Civil 3D class. Class prices vary widely, from several hundred dollars for a basic course, to several thousand for a comprehensive program. In many cases, you’ll receive free access to Civil 3D while you are taking a class.
